Drawing Tablet Compatibility
I've used a Wacom Intuos Art with Scratch for over a year and I've never faced any problems. Perhaps change the tablet mapping settings, that worked for some other sites that the tablet was iffy with.

Drawing Tablet Compatibility
If you have a Wacom intuos, go to the settings, go to Mapping, then turn of Windows Ink.

Do you mind sharing a video of the drawing on Scratch using your tablet? I'm especially curious as to pressure sensitivity. Did you say that works in Scratch? (Or do you just mean in general?) I'd be a bit surprised, since I don't believe the Scratch paint editor has any code to handle pressure sensitivity (I'm not sure web browsers can even detect that in the first place, without additional third-party plugins).
